Off Season Hours Mon - Fri 8am to 3:30 pm Visitor Center Hours (Memorial Day to Labor Day) Mon - Fri 8:00 am to 3:30 pm Sat - Sun 10:00 am to 3:00pm About Us WebCHEYENNE - Wyoming has a new state record shovelnose sturgeon thanks to the efforts of Powell angler Clint Franklin. Franklin’s sturgeon weighed 10 pounds 4.2 oz. ounces and bested the previous record by a little over two ounces. Franklin was fishing for catfish on Bighorn Reservoir near Lovell the night of August 7 when the fish took his minnow.

WebShovelnose Sturgeon Reddish-brown or buff color Found throughout Missouri and Mississippi rivers Rarely exceeds 30 inches in length or 5 pounds Bases of barbels form a straight line Thin scale-like plates on belly Long slender filament on tip of tail, if not broken off Length from snout to barbels is the same as barbels to mouth WebThis active, big-river fish formerly occurred along the entire length of the Missouri River. In the 1940s, it constituted 31 percent of all small fishes in the Missouri River! By the early 1980s, that figure was 1.1 percent. Today, it has all but vanished from our state. Goldstripe Darter.
